Ticket: Deep-link routing drift on Android builds

We're seeing users of the Quillhop app land on the generic home screen instead of the intended order-detail view. Comparing the staging and prod routing manifests shows the prod build is running an older host-pattern set, likely from a manual hotfix in March that never made it back into the deploy pipeline. Support can reproduce it on any order link. The current drifted prod values are pasted below for reference.

deployment values, fahap-hahaf:
[casdor]
port = 9200
region = south-2
host = casdor.qirvanworks.corp
timeout_ms = 3000
retries = 4

## Idempotency Keys for Payment Retries (Lumopay)

Every retry of a charge request must reuse the original idempotency key; generating a new key on retry can produce duplicate charges. Keys are scoped per merchant and expire after 48 hours. Reviewers should verify keys are derived server-side, never from client input. The full key-generation specification and threat model are maintained on the internal page.

dashboard of kaguf-tawip = https://vault.merlaqsys.test/issue

## Configuration

Twigsweep (our stale-branch cleanup bot) reads everything from a single .env file — no config UI, which should make your review easier. TWIG_MAX_AGE_DAYS and TWIG_PROTECTED_BRANCHES are plain values; dry-run is on by default. The only sensitive item is the credential Twigsweep uses to delete branches, scoped to delete-only on the Larkmoor forge. It never touches code contents. Directly after the protected-branches line, the env file must contain this line:

env line for kahof-yahag: RELAY_SECRET5=224bf